Carol Castro

Carol Castro

Carol Castro's Rating: 8.69/10info

Based on 112 votes from Hotness Rater voters

Won Against

  • Viktoria Odintsova taking a selfie
    9.61/10
    Alina Puscau
    9.19/10
    Pia Muehlenbeck
    9.17/10
  • Sharam Diniz
    9.16/10
    Christina Ricci
    9.13/10
    Ashley Tisdale
    8.99/10
  • Natalia Vodianova
    8.84/10
    Hailee Steinfeld
    8.82/10
    Willow Shields
    8.81/10
  • Angela Baby
    8.80/10
    Demi-Leigh Nel-Peters
    8.80/10
    Blanca Padilla
    8.80/10

Lost Against

  • Vanessa Lengies - Chuck Connelly Art Opening at Trigg Ison Fine Arts -- Los Angeles, Oct. 29, 2009
    8.63/10
    Molly Quinn
    8.55/10
    Adriana Lynn
    8.55/10
  • Haifa Wehbe
    8.54/10
    Jennifer Connelly
    8.51/10
    Sophie Shallai
    8.50/10
  • Lyz Brickley- Ciri Cosplay
    8.50/10
    Inés Sastre
    8.46/10
    Beverley Mitchell
    8.45/10
  • Lei Ke Er
    8.43/10
    Nikia A
    8.35/10
    Juliette Binoche
    8.27/10